Output d8d57e2268bda1813c7606fb28c4f09f65f1e0e3af927488578f704fc109e206:28

value
312950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 252e0757e78f0cd4dcfd219360435a8448b3a7a8 OP_EQUAL
address
355c4meVzAK9byDhPi9sTVo1q4iG5i31YG
transaction
d8d57e2268bda1813c7606fb28c4f09f65f1e0e3af927488578f704fc109e206
spent
true